Solution
The correct option is D zero Magnetic field due to a current carrying wire is given by, B=μ0I2πr and for direction, point the thumb along the direction of current then curl the fingers around will represents the direction of the magnetic field. In case of two infinitely long wires carrying currents in the same direction, the field due to both of them at a point P which is lying midway between them will cancel each other and their resultant will be zero.
